Exterior Description And Setting


A dressed granite post on north verge of road. Measures c.30 x 20 cm in cross section; 35cm protrudes above ground. Rounded corners to top. Side facing to south finely dressed and inscribed PBW in 5cm high capital letters.

Historical Information


One of a number of stones marking the course of the Portadown and Banbridge Waterworks pipeline from Foffany Dam, opened in 1909. See also HB 16/07/048, /062, and /063 for identical stones. Shown on 1919 OS 6” map. There is a modern concrete marker post replacement immediately to its west. Primary sources: 1. OS maps, 4th edition, 1919, Co Down sheet 48.
